  • Rawcliffe Manor Care Home, York
Residential and Dementia care is provided for both permanent, respite and day care, in separate areas of the home. Dementia care is provided in the Haven area.

Luxury facilities include an in-house bar, a full beauty salon and hairdressing room and cinema room. The facilities will be used on a daily basis by visiting friends and family, and in a varied activities programme 7 days a week. All the bedrooms are large, with some premium bedrooms of over 26sqm each, and all include a full ensuite wet room. The majority of the ground floor bedrooms include doors out to private patio areas.

The care home is situated on Coningham Avenue, and is well placed for easy access Clifton Retail Park and the Lysander Arms.

Admission Criteria

  • The care home welcomes applications for admission from individuals who require residential or dementia care. All admissions are based on an assessment of the individual’s care needs to ensure the home can provide appropriate support and a safe, comfortable environment. Before admission, a thorough assessment is carried out in consultation with the individual, their family, and relevant professionals. This includes reviewing health, personal, and social care needs, as well as preferences and lifestyle choices, to ensure a personalised care plan can be developed. Admissions are offered subject to the availability of suitable accommodation and the ability of the home to meet the assessed needs. Priority is given to ensuring that every resident’s safety, dignity, and wellbeing are maintained at all times. Trial visits or short stays may be offered where appropriate, to support a smooth transition into the home. The care home reserves the right to decline an admission if it is determined that the individual’s needs cannot be safely or appropriately met.

Review from L N (Wife of Resident) published on 3 January 2024 Submitted via Website • Report
Overall Experience 3.0 out of 5
My husband has dementia and is double incontinent. He stayed at Rawcliffe Manor for two weeks respite. I visited him at 10.00 am and found that his cooked breakfast had been placed on his desk and was stone cold. He was lying in bed soaked in urine, as were his clothes and bedding. I went to get
help and spoke to a carer. She said 'I thought there was a smell when I took his breakfast in'. I then asked for him to be showered. The response was 'he had a shower yesterday'. It doesn't matter how many showers he had, he needed one then. This should not have needed me to chase this.
I handed in a letter, addressed to the manager when I collected my husband.
When I unpacked, I found that my husband had no socks returned, in fact he had been sent home in leather shoes, minus socks. Also, his toothbrush and toothpaste had not been used.
I then sent an email to the Yorkare company, who did respond to say that they would look into the matter. No, they did not get back to me.
Reply from Charlie Harris, Home Manager at Rawcliffe Manor Care Home

We apologise for not providing our usual high standard of care. As a result of this incident we provided further training for the care team involved on the day of your husband's discharge and discussed your concerns with the whole team to ensure this does not happen again. I was assured by the team member that you spoke to that the comment that your husband had a shower the previous day was not intended to mean that he could not have one every day if it was requested or required. This comment was merely made as a reassurance that your husband has had showers since his admission. We offer showers or baths daily if requested for any resident. Our Area Manager also reviewed our actions in response to the complaint.
Since your meeting with our Dementia Care Manager, to discuss the concerns in your letter, we did attempt to contact you by email, telephone and post but we did not get a response. We are happy to discuss this with you and have attempted to call you again today.

Overview of Review Score

The Review Score of 9.4 (9.442) out of 10 for Rawcliffe Manor Care Home is based on a) the Average Rating and b) the number of positive Reviews.

  1. The Average Rating is 4.5 out of 5 from 14 Reviews in the last 24 months.
  2. The score for the number of positive Reviews is 4.9 out of 5 from 12 positive Reviews in the last 24 months.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  1. 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months. The Average Rating of 4.546 for Rawcliffe Manor Care Home is calculated as follows: ( (113 Excellents x 5) + (33 Goods x 4) + (13 Satisfactorys x 3) + (1 Poors x 2) + (3 Very Poors x 1) ) ÷ 163 Ratings = 4.546
  2. 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5'). The 4.896 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Rawcliffe Manor Care Home is based on 12 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    1. 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 = 4
    2. 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 67 registered maximum number of service users is 13.4. 12 Positive Reviews ÷ 13.4 = 0.896
  3. When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.
  4. If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
